Понимание взаимосвязи между виртуальной машиной виртуальной машины и технологией распределенного реестра DLT в контексте криптовалюты

Криптовалюта

В мире криптовалют часто встречаются два термина: VM (виртуальная машина) и DLT (технология распределенного реестра). Эти две концепции играют решающую роль в функционировании различных криптовалют, таких как Биткойн и Эфириум. Понимание взаимосвязи между виртуальными машинами и распределенным леджером является ключом к пониманию того, как работают криптовалюты и какой потенциал они таят в себе в будущем.

Виртуальная машина (ВМ) — это программная эмуляция физического компьютера. Это позволяет одновременно запускать несколько операционных систем на одной физической машине. В контексте криптовалют виртуальная машина используется для выполнения смарт-контрактов. Смарт-контракты — это самоисполняющиеся контракты с заранее определенными правилами и условиями, которые хранятся в блокчейне. Используя виртуальную машину, разработчики могут создавать и запускать децентрализованные приложения (DApps) в сети блокчейна, обеспечивая большую автоматизацию и эффективность в различных секторах.

С другой стороны, технология распределенного реестра (DLT) является базовой технологией, лежащей в основе криптовалют. Это относится к децентрализованной базе данных, которая поддерживается несколькими участниками (узлами) в разных местах. DLT гарантирует, что каждая транзакция записывается и проверяется сетью, что делает ее безопасной и прозрачной.Наиболее известной реализацией ТРР является блокчейн, который представляет собой тип ТРР, который организует данные в блоки, соединенные в хронологическую цепочку. Это гарантирует, что реестр защищен от несанкционированного доступа и неизменяем, что делает его идеальным для хранения финансовых транзакций.

Введение:

Виртуальная машина (VM) и технология распределенного реестра (DLT) — две фундаментальные концепции в области криптовалют. Понимание взаимосвязи между этими двумя концепциями необходимо для понимания основных механизмов современных криптовалют, таких как Биткойн и Эфириум.

Виртуальная машина, также известная как виртуальная среда или уровень виртуализации, представляет собой абстракцию аппаратных ресурсов, которая позволяет запускать несколько операционных систем или приложений на одном физическом сервере или компьютере. Он обеспечивает изолированную и независимую среду для каждого приложения, обеспечивая их эффективное и безопасное выполнение.

Промокоды на Займер на скидки

Займы для физических лиц под низкий процент

  • 💲Сумма: от 2 000 до 30 000 рублей
  • 🕑Срок: от 7 до 30 дней
  • 👍Первый заём для новых клиентов — 0%, повторный — скидка 500 руб

С другой стороны, DLT — это децентрализованная и прозрачная система, которая обеспечивает безопасное и эффективное хранение и управление цифровыми транзакциями и записями. Он использует распределенную сеть узлов, которые коллективно поддерживают общий реестр, обеспечивая целостность и неизменяемость записанных данных.

В контексте криптовалют виртуальные машины часто используются для создания и выполнения смарт-контрактов. Смарт-контракты — это самоисполняющиеся контракты, условия которых непосредственно записаны в коде. Они автоматически выполняют условия контракта при выполнении определенных заранее определенных условий. Использование виртуальных машин позволяет выполнять код смарт-контрактов безопасным и изолированным образом, предотвращая вредоносные действия и обеспечивая целостность контракта.

С другой стороны, DLT играет решающую роль в обеспечении прозрачности и безопасности криптовалютных транзакций. Используя распределенную сеть узлов, DLT предотвращает единую точку отказа и обеспечивает целостность записей транзакций.Каждая транзакция записывается в блок, который затем добавляется в цепочку блоков, образуя блокчейн. Использование DLT добавляет дополнительный уровень безопасности и доверия к криптовалютным транзакциям.

Кратко представить концепции виртуальной машины виртуальной машины и технологии распределенного реестра DLT.

Виртуальная машина виртуальной машины — это программная или аппаратная система, которая имитирует физический компьютер и может выполнять программы или приложения. Он действует как промежуточный уровень между аппаратным и программным обеспечением, позволяя запускать несколько операционных систем на одной физической машине. Виртуальная машина предоставляет виртуализированную среду, которая изолирует каждую операционную систему, гарантируя, что любые изменения, внесенные в одну ОС, не повлияют на другие. Это обеспечивает эффективное распределение ресурсов и улучшает использование системы.

С другой стороны, технология распределенного реестра DLT — это децентрализованная и прозрачная система, которая позволяет участникам записывать, хранить и проверять транзакции на нескольких компьютерах или узлах. В отличие от традиционных централизованных систем, в которых реестр контролируется одним лицом, DLT распределяет копии реестра по нескольким узлам, что делает его более безопасным и устойчивым к несанкционированному вмешательству или модификациям. Одним из ключевых компонентов ТРР является блокчейн, тип ТРР, который хранит данные транзакций в блоках, связанных друг с другом в цепочку.

Объясните их важность в контексте криптовалюты.

И VM (виртуальная машина), и DLT (технология распределенного реестра) играют решающую роль в мире криптовалют. Это важные компоненты, которые способствуют безопасности, масштабируемости и децентрализации криптовалют.

Виртуальные машины, такие как виртуальная машина Ethereum (EVM), позволяют выполнять смарт-контракты, которые представляют собой самоисполняющиеся контракты, условия которых непосредственно записаны в коде. Эти смарт-контракты хранятся и исполняются в блокчейне, что делает их защищенными от несанкционированного доступа и прозрачными.Виртуальная машина обеспечивает безопасную среду для выполнения этих контрактов, гарантируя, что они работают точно так, как задумано, и не могут быть изменены или манипулированы внешними сторонами. Это обеспечивает целостность транзакций и устраняет необходимость в посредниках, таких как банки или правовые системы, в транзакциях с криптовалютой.

С другой стороны, DLT — это базовая технология, лежащая в основе таких криптовалют, как Биткойн и Эфириум. Это децентрализованная база данных, которая распределяет записи транзакций по нескольким узлам или компьютерам. Такая распределенная природа делает DLT по своей сути более безопасным и устойчивым к взлому или манипуляциям. Это также обеспечивает прозрачность и неизменность транзакций, позволяя любому проверить действительность транзакций, не полагаясь на централизованный орган.

DLT также облегчает механизм консенсуса, используемый в криптовалютных сетях. В Биткойне, например, алгоритм консенсуса Proof-of-Work (PoW) основан на решении майнерами сложных математических задач для проверки и добавления новых блоков в блокчейн. Этот децентрализованный механизм консенсуса гарантирует, что ни один объект не сможет контролировать сеть или манипулировать историей транзакций. Аналогичным образом, Ethereum переходит на алгоритм консенсуса Proof-of-Stake (PoS), который потребует от пользователей хранить и блокировать определенное количество своей криптовалюты в качестве залога для проверки транзакций и защиты сети.

В целом сочетание виртуальных машин и распределенного реестра обеспечивает необходимую инфраструктуру для создания и использования криптовалют. Виртуальные машины позволяют выполнять смарт-контракты, а DLT обеспечивает безопасность, прозрачность и децентрализацию транзакций. Вместе они создают надежную и эффективную систему для проведения криптовалютных транзакций без необходимости в посредниках или централизованном контроле.

Экспертные ответы на вопросы о криптовалюте: расширьте свои знания

Что такое виртуальная машина и как она связана с DLT?
Виртуальная машина или виртуальная машина — это программная эмуляция физического компьютера.В контексте DLT виртуальная машина используется для выполнения смарт-контрактов, которые представляют собой самоисполняющиеся контракты, условия которых непосредственно записаны в коде. DLT, или технология распределенного реестра, представляет собой систему децентрализованных и распределенных цифровых записей, в которой информация хранится на нескольких узлах или компьютерах. Виртуальная машина часто используется в системах распределенного реестра для создания виртуальной среды, в которой могут выполняться смарт-контракты.
Почему виртуальная машина необходима для выполнения смарт-контрактов в системах распределенного реестра?
Виртуальная машина необходима для выполнения смарт-контрактов в системах распределенного реестра, поскольку она обеспечивает безопасную и изолированную среду, в которой может выполняться код смарт-контракта. При использовании виртуальной машины код смарт-контракта выполняется в изолированной среде, что означает, что он изолирован от базовой системы и не может получать доступ к данным или изменять их за пределами назначенной области. Это помогает обеспечить целостность и безопасность системы DLT.
Как виртуальная машина взаимодействует с системой DLT?
Виртуальная машина взаимодействует с системой распределенного реестра, предоставляя среду выполнения смарт-контрактов. Когда смарт-контракт развертывается в системе DLT, код контракта хранится в сети DLT и выполняется виртуальной машиной. Виртуальная машина интерпретирует код и выполняет инструкции контракта, что может включать взаимодействие с сетью DLT, доступ к данным и их изменение, а также выполнение вычислений. Виртуальная машина обеспечивает безопасность выполнения смарт-контракта и соответствует правилам и протоколам системы DLT.
Каковы преимущества использования виртуальной машины в системе DLT?
Использование виртуальной машины в системе DLT имеет несколько преимуществ. Во-первых, он обеспечивает безопасную и изолированную среду выполнения смарт-контрактов, что помогает предотвратить несанкционированный доступ или изменение данных. Во-вторых, это позволяет выполнять сложные и программируемые контракты, поскольку виртуальная машина может интерпретировать и выполнять широкий спектр кода.В-третьих, он обеспечивает согласованную и стандартизированную среду выполнения, которая упрощает разработку, тестирование и развертывание смарт-контрактов на различных платформах DLT. В целом использование виртуальной машины повышает функциональность, безопасность и совместимость систем DLT.
Может ли система DLT работать без виртуальной машины?
Да, система DLT может работать без виртуальной машины, но наличие виртуальной машины дает ряд преимуществ. Без виртуальной машины среду выполнения смарт-контрактов должна была бы обеспечивать базовая система или платформа, которая может не иметь такого же уровня безопасности, изоляции и гибкости, как выделенная виртуальная машина. Кроме того, использование виртуальной машины позволяет выполнять смарт-контракты на разных платформах распределенного реестра, поскольку виртуальная машина обеспечивает стандартизированную и согласованную среду. Без виртуальной машины разработчикам придется адаптировать свои смарт-контракты к конкретной среде выполнения каждой платформы распределенного реестра, что может занять много времени и быть менее эффективным.

❓За участие в опросе консультация бесплатно